Unlike everyone else on Amazon.com I've thankfully (knock on desk) only had good experiences with both Norton Personal Firewall 2004 & Noron AntiVirus 2004.

It does take PERSISTANCE to train the Firewall properly and to get comfortable with the IE security and Cookie settings, but after about 2 weeks of teaching the software its been gravy... and I thankfully haven't had any major intrusions, file corruptions or viruses that I'm aware of in the past 8-months.

Downloading updates is seamless, I don't have memory hog issues on my AMD 3200+ w/512 MB Ram, Windows XP SP2 and my high speed DSL connection that's always on. I've turned off Symantec's Popup Blocker and configured the built in one with XP SP2. I set IE to prompt each time a website asks to install cookies. I've set the Firewall security setting to "High-Block Everything Until I approve it". Other than that, I manage Java Applet & Active X security within IE. I did try setting these to "Medium - ask me each time" and it worked as well. Really, the first 2-weeks in which you visit most of your key banking, finance, news, gaming and other websites is the important period which REQUIRES PATIENCE. The trick again is teaching the firewall which sites you approve and which you don't. According to various studies, the average internet user spends 80% of their online time on less than 10 websites. After the first 2-weeks, its the 20% you just have to teach yourself and other users of your computer to be smart about.

If you're not very comfortable with computers and are only a basic user of e-mail, news & regular websites... this is a great program as long as you have a techno-savvy son/daughter, friend or colleague who can help you set it up the first time. If you're a pretty advanced technology buff you'll appreciate the integrated management console between all Norton Programs and will like most of the features. Overall.. it's 4 stars in my book.
